Any changes in your Part B premiums aren't related to your income but to your individual Social Security benefits.

For 2017, your premiums can rise by not more than 0.three % of your Social Security benefits. That’s as a result of the 2017 cost of residing adjustment, or COLA, was 0.three %, and Social Security’s “maintain harmless” rule limits your higher Part B premiums to this amount. Just as crucial benefit of Part C plans is the annual out of pocket spend safety, the main determinant of monthly premium variations is the scale of that safety. By regulation, a Part C beneficiary can not spend more than $6700 out of pocket annually on medical services; it is plans with this limit that have the bottom premiums. Conversely, some Part C plans have OOP limits as little as $1500 annually but in fact -- for these plans -- the premium is greater. Note that an OOP limit just isn't a deductible as is often reported.

The bids are in comparison with the pre-decided benchmark amounts set, that are the maximum amount Medicare will pay a plan in a given county. If a plan's bid is larger than the benchmark, enrollees pay the distinction between the benchmark and the bid within the form of a month-to-month premium, in addition to the Medicare Part B premium.
